    Abstract: A pretreatment process, carried out prior to a developing process, spouts pure water, namely, a diffusion-assisting liquid for assisting the spread of a developer over the surface of a wafer, through a cleaning liquid spouting nozzle onto a central part of the wafer to form a puddle of pure water. The developer is spouted onto the central part of the wafer for prewetting while the wafer is rotated at a high rotating speed to spread the developer over the surface of the wafer. The developer dissolves the resist film partly and produces a solution. The rotation of the wafer is reversed, for example, within 7 s in which the solution is being produced to reduce the water-repellency of the wafer by spreading the solution over the entire surface of the wafer. Then, the developer is spouted onto the rotating wafer to spread the developer on the surface of the wafer.

    Abstract: A liquid crystal display device includes a liquid crystal display panel and a driving circuit that supplies display signals to a plurality of subpixels of the liquid crystal display panel. The plurality of subpixels are a red subpixel, a green subpixel, a blue subpixel, and a yellow subpixel. When achromatic colors of at least some gray levels among all gray levels are to be displayed by the pixel, display signals which are supplied to a first subpixel group composed of certain two subpixels are display signals of the same grayscale level, whereas display signals which are supplied to a second subpixel group composed of the other two subpixels are display signals of a different grayscale level from the grayscale level of the display signals supplied to the first subpixel group. The first subpixel group includes the yellow subpixel, and the second subpixel group includes the blue subpixel.

    Abstract: A coating and developing apparatus develops a substrate of which surface is coated with resist and exposed to lights. The coating and developing apparatus includes a developing module; a cleaning module; and a transfer mechanism configured to transfer a substrate developed by the developing module to the cleaning module. The developing module includes an airtightly sealed processing vessel configured to form a processing atmosphere; a temperature control plate provided in the processing vessel and mounts thereon the substrate and cools the substrate; and an atmosphere gas supply unit configured to supply an atmosphere gas including mist of a developing solution to a surface of the substrate within the processing vessel. The cleaning module includes a mounting table configured to mount thereon the substrate; and a cleaning solution supply unit configured to supply a cleaning solution to the substrate mounted on the mounting table.

    Abstract: To provide a substrate holding apparatus which can prevent a liquid from entering into a rear surface side of a substrate. A substrate holding apparatus (PH) is provided with a base material (PHB), a first holding portion (PH1) formed on the base material (PHB) for holding the substrate (P), and a second holding portion (PH2) formed on the base material (PHB) for holding a plate member (T) by surrounding the circumference of a processing substrate (P) held by the first holding portion (PH1). The second holding portion (PH2) holds the plate member (T) so as to form a second space (32) on the side of the rear surface (Tb) of the plate member (T). On the rear surface (Tb) of the plate member (T), an absorbing member (100) is arranged for absorbing the liquid (LQ) entered from a gap (A) between the substrate (P) held by the first holding portion (PH1) and the plate member (T) held by the second holding portion (PH2).
